    Bulk Carriers: Handle with Care, 2nd Edition

    £15.00
    Bulk carriers must be handled with care in port as well as at sea. Stevedores and ships' officers responsible for cargo operations become key partners for ship safety, because the lives of seafarers may ultimately depend on careful cargo handling. Ship-to-shore planning, information and communication become vital.

    Best Practice Guidelines for Stowage and Securing of Steel Cargoes

    £125.00
    These Guidelines have been developed to assist shipmasters, ship's officers, port Captains, load port agents and stevedores, charterers and shippers when planning to load steel cargoes that are bound for Malaysia or Singapore and the following Ports are unequivocal in their endorsement of the Guidelines and are fully committed to ensuring enforcement of compliance: Johor Port, Jurong Port, Northport (Malaysia), Penang Port and Westports Malaysia.
